Furkan KAPAN
System Engineer at detera
+1 234 567 890
furkan.kapan@fkteknoloji.com
http://furkankapan.com
Yunus Emre Cd., No: 50
Veri tabanı sorgularınızı hızlandırın. B-Tree, Hash ve Composite indeksler ile WHERE, JOIN ve ORDER BY işlemlerini optimize edin, sorgu sürelerini ciddi şekilde kısaltın.
Veri tabanlarında büyük veri setlerinde sorguların hızlı çalışması için index (indeks) kullanımı kritik bir rol oynar. Doğru indeks stratejileri, sorgu sürelerini ciddi şekilde kısaltabilir ve sistem performansını artırabilir.
Bir veri tabanı indeks, tablo içindeki verilerin daha hızlı bulunmasını sağlayan özel bir veri yapısıdır.
Kitaplarda olduğu gibi “içindekiler tablosu” gibi çalışır.
Sorgularda WHERE, JOIN ve ORDER BY kullanılan kolonlara indeks eklemek performansı artırır.
Çok sık güncellenen kolonlara dikkat edin; gereksiz indeksler write performansını düşürebilir.
B-Tree Index: En yaygın kullanılan ve range query’lerde hızlıdır.
Hash Index: Tekil aramalarda etkilidir; range query’lerde uygun değildir.
Composite Index: Birden fazla kolonu kapsayan indeks; JOIN ve filtrelemelerde avantaj sağlar.
Veri tabanı optimizer’larının kullandığı execution plan’ları inceleyerek indekslerin etkinliğini kontrol edin.
Sık kullanılan sorguların performansını analiz ederek eksik indeksleri tespit edin.
Rebuild veya reorganize işlemleri ile indekslerin fragmentasyonunu azaltın.
Düzenli bakım, sorgu sürelerini uzun vadede optimize eder.
Gereksiz veya duplicate indekslerden kaçının.
Veri tabanı boyutuna ve sorgu tipine göre stratejik indeksleme yapın.
E-posta hesabınız yayımlanmayacak. Gerekli alanlar işaretlendi *